I installed a BBK offroad X-pipe w/ my stock catback yesterday and I'm really happy w/ the sound and power! It's a little raspier than I'd like but sounds great under acceleration and settles down at cruise. Big SOTP improvement and the 1-2 shift completely busts the tires loose.

Money wasn't the issue and I'll probably still do a catback later, but what a great way for someone to do an exhaust on the cheap! If you're looking for power and a non-chambered sound, do the H or X-pipe first and wait-and-hear on a catback, IMO.

I had the same thing happen on my '98 GT when I switched to an offroad X from a Bassani X w/ cats. I did the Flowmaster catback first, sounded stock w/ the factory H, added the Bassani, sounded better but quiet, felt faster and picked up a tenth. Removed the Bassani for the offroad X, felt like I lost torque (acceleration), sounded GREAT, but actually picked up two tenths...GO FIGURE!
